Do Debt Consolidation Companies Work and What Do They Do ?

During these challenging economic times many people are struggling just to be able to make ends meet as they deal with the twin challenges of large amounts of debt and a slowing economy. For most this means that their levels of stress and worry rise as they struggle to find a way to be able to find a solution to their problem. One area that millions of people are turning to is debt consolidation, this is when you a hire a company to negotiate with your creditors and consolidate all of your outstanding debt down to one payment with one low interest rate. While this may sound very encouraging the big question is does debt consolidation really work?

The answer is both yes and no, what happen is when you are consolidating down your debt you are taking out a loan to do this. This means that if you follow the program laid out by the debt consolidation company you will be effective at reducing your overall levels of debt while helping to improve your credit rating at the same time. However, there are those individuals who perform debt consolidation yet they do not control their spending, which caused them have high levels of debt to begin with, the consolidation causes them to reduce their overall monthly payment but they continue taking out more loans and spending without restraint. This creates a situation where they have the amount that they consolidated down along with other loans that they took out after the consolidation was done; effectively causing them to make their situation even worse because they did not follow the consolidation plan or control their spending.

Clearly consolidation of debt can work effectively provided that you control your spending and follow the plan which the debt consolidation company has laid out for you. If you can do this then debt consolidation will work for you. However, if you do not control your spending after the consolidation has taken place then you will only make your situation even worse than before.
